Services and pricing
Apple Remodeling prices labor on a per-hour basis rather than marking up material costs or bundling jobs into flat-rate packages. Labor rates should be confirmed directly with the company, as contractor rates in the Baltimore region typically range from $50 to $85 per hour depending on complexity and whether permits are required. Material costs are passed through separately, often with a markup of 10 to 20 percent to cover ordering and waste. A typical mid-range bathroom renovation in Baltimore runs $15,000 to $35,000; kitchens often reach $30,000 to $60,000 or more depending on cabinet choices, countertop material, and appliance selection.
Most general contractors in the area charge a deposit (often 25 to 50 percent) before work starts, with draws at project milestones. Confirm Apple Remodeling's deposit terms and payment schedule before signing an agreement.
How it compares to other Baltimore general contractors
Baltimore has a dense field of remodeling contractors. Firms like Cornerstone Contracting and local kitchen specialists tend to bundle labor and material markups into single project estimates, making per-job comparison harder. Apple Remodeling's fixed hourly labor rate appeals to owners who want cost transparency and are comfortable tracking hours; this works well for projects where scope stays predictable, but can create friction if design changes pile on unexpected labor. Contractors who charge by the project shield you from hourly uncertainty at the cost of less visibility into what you are paying for labor versus materials.
For Baltimore homeowners comparing bids, request itemized labor hours and material costs separately from at least two other contractors. A kitchen renovation quote should clearly state whether permits, inspections, and cleanup are included or billed separately.

What the first visit involves
Initial contact typically leads to an in-home consultation where the contractor walks the space, takes measurements, discusses finishes and materials, and establishes a rough timeline. Some contractors include this consultation at no charge; others bill a small fee, often credited toward the final contract. You should bring reference photos, a wish list, and a realistic budget range. The contractor will assess whether permits are needed (most kitchen and bathroom updates in Baltimore require them) and clarify what that adds to timeline and cost.
After the walk-through, expect a formal estimate within one to two weeks, itemizing labor hours (estimated), material quantities, and any subcontractor fees such as plumbing or electrical work.
